CHRISTIAN SERVICE
Christian Service helps those in need with corporal works of mercy. Includes: funeral lunches, monthly coffee and donut Sunday, St. Joseph Layette (items for newborns), Stars of Christmas (clothing and toys for needy children), two blood drives annually, MCREST (meals for the homeless), bake sales (to help with expenses for our Rosary Makers), Sunshine Lady (sends cards to parishioners for special birthdays), prepares meals for special clergy luncheons/dinners.

Grief Support Ministry
To help parishioners and others who are grieving the loss of a loved one. Funeral Greeters are on-site the day of the funeral to assist the family and guests. We mail “CareNotes” and letters of support during the first year of loss. There are also as-needed support gatherings for those grieving regardless of the time it has been since the loss.
